The Svalbard Integrated Arctic Earth Observing System (SIOS) is seeking an experienced, creative and executive person to lead the continued development of SIOS as the director. The SIOS consortium coordinates state-of-the-art research infrastructure and observing capacity, owned by the members, in order to foster excellent environmental and climate change research in the Svalbard region.

The Director will play a central role in developing SIOS in direct contact with the SIOS Board of Directors and also with users and stakeholders.

The responsibilities of the Director include following:

  • Serve as SIOS official representative
  • Co-ordinate and implement the SIOS plans
  • Take initiatives to develop SIOS further
  • Lead the day-to-day operations of SIOS-KC
  • Take the lead in assembling and guiding work groups and task forces towards the goals allocated by the SIOS Board of Directors and General Assembly
  • Stimulate, follow, coordinate and when appropriate lead processes of acquiring external funding for the furthering of SIOS
  • Report to the SIOS Board of Directors and the SIOS General Assembly
  • Serve as Director for SIOS Svalbard AS and in that capacity report to the Board of Directors of SIOS Svalbard AS

The position is located at the Knowledge Centre in Longyearbyen, Svalbard.
